In a rustic kitchen a farmer examines a portrait that his young son has drawn on a slate as the rest of the family look on admiringly. Knight's paintings of rural families and boys at play relied upon genre types developed a few decades before by David Wilkie and William Mulready. Knight here echoes a theme found in the biographies of famous artists--Vasari, for example, recorded how Giotto, when a shepherd boy, drew pictures of his flock on rocks that attracted the attention of the Florentine painter Cimabue, who then took the youth on as an apprentice. This print, executed by the leading engraver Thomas, was published one year before Knight’s early death at the age of forty, and the related oil painting is at the Tunbridge Wells Museum and Gallery.
